// Canary gating for the Birchfall deploy pipeline.
// Promotion requires: error rate < 0.5% over 15 min,
// p99 latency within 10% of baseline, zero failed health probes.
// Any violation auto-rolls-back; overrides need two approvers.
// The gate client below talks to the Wardline policy service
// and authenticates with the following key.

API key for kahop-bagef: zpat2_yb

Handover — Brindlecore ORM refactor

Plugin authors: legacy mappers in Brindlecore are frozen. New adapters go through the QueryBridge interface; old `Mapper` subclasses still compile but emit deprecation warnings and will be removed next cycle. Migration shims live in the compat module; tests must pass against both paths until cutover. Fixture DB snapshots are in the sealed archive. The archive and the staging credentials vault share one unlock; when prompted during setup, enter the recovery passphrase given on the next line.

unlock words, kagef-taduf: fenir-quenix-norwyn-sorvan-gormir-gorir-fraok

## Deployment

LockerLoop handles the laundry-locker access flow: customer scans, door pops, status syncs. Deploys go through the Harwick pipeline; staging first, prod after smoke tests pass. Rollback is one command. Door firmware is versioned separately — don't bundle it. For the sync: two deploys shipped this week, zero incidents. Prod currently runs with the configuration values listed below.

deployment values, kajep-kageg:
[praix]
host = praix.paliqcorp.corp
user = praix_svc
database = praix_prod

Runbook — Hot Reload, Marrowgate Config Service

Reviewers: the watcher process detects file changes, validates the new config against the schema, and swaps it atomically; invalid files are rejected and the previous config stays live. Reload events are logged with a checksum. Never restart the service to pick up changes — that defeats the drain logic. Verify the reload behavior against the configuration values below.

config for tagep-yajef:
ulawyn:
  log_level: error
  metrics_host: metrics.ulawyn.lumiclabs.internal
  pin: 0564
  pool_size: 32